背景资料5-aminolevulinate synthase 1 (ALAS-H) and 2 (ALAS-E) are two isoforms of ALAS,
an enzyme catalyzing the first step of the heme biosynthetic pathway in
mammals. The erythroid-specific isoenzyme, ALAS-E, regulates the first step of
hematopoietic cell differentation and iron metabolism in the liver. ALAS-H is a
housekeeping protein which mediates synthesis of early heme in the mitochondria
of most cells. Succinyl CoA associates with ALAS-E in protein conformation
change and translocation of ALAS-E into the mitochondria and does not interact
with ALAS-H. The ALAS-E 5'-flanking region contains binding sites for nuclear
activators such as GATA-1, NF-E2 and EKLF. Since the ALAS e maps to the X
chromosome, mutation of the e leads to the pyridoxine-refractory X-linked
sideroblastic anemia.
